Peggy was born in Mitchell County on October 6, 1927 to the late W.H. Thomas and Georgia Bell Thomas. She was a life long member of Oak Grove Baptist Church, Nebo and was considered by her family to be the All American Granny. She loved to cook, paint, and write poetry.
In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her husband, Kenneth Clayton Benfield, two sons, David Benfield and Kenneth Benfield and a grandson, David James Williams.
Survivors include her two sons of Nebo; three daughters of Morganton, and Daughter-in-law of Morganton. Also surviving are her two brothers of Newland and of Penn Laird, VA.; twenty grandchildren, twenty-three great-grandchildren, and two great- great-grandchildren.
A Celebration of Life will be held at Oak Grove Baptist Church with Rev. Gyles Widener officiating.
